Summary The Yablunivske field is one of the most depleted field of Dnipro-Donetsk Depression, but at the same time it is the place of implementation of the production program for the modernization and intensification of the fields. Obtaining an understanding of the characteristics of the sedimentary rocks allows us to make conclusions about their possibility to hydrocarbon production. The authors have creating a basis for further modelling and the analysis of indicators of petrophysical parameters and the selection of the main correlating dependencies. The purpose of this work is to create a mathematical model of the rocks of the Bashkir’s and Serpukhiv’s layers of the well 1 of the Yablunivske field based on petrophysical data. The statistical analysis consisted in the construction of histograms of the distribution of the values of each of the parameters under different conditions, construction of the dependences of petrophysical parameters. The authors have achieved the results by creating the following dependencies, such as: bulk - mineral density before extraction, bulk density - coefficient of open porosity before extraction, bulk density - coefficient of open porosity after extraction, coefficient of permeability - coefficient of open porosity before extarction, coefficient of permeability - coefficient of open porosity after extraction.
